World's 7 biggest Oil and Gas Companies



Saudi Aramco:

Saudi Arabia is a crucial country in supplying the world oil markets, and Saudi Aramco plays an important part in it. Saudi Aramco, a fully integrated, global petroleum and chemicals enterprise, is the state-owned oil company of the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ia.

It plays a key role in the global economy by maintaining substantial spare crude oil production capacity to contribute stability to worldwide oil prices. This leading company has become a world leader in hydrocarbons exploration, production, refining, distribution, shipping and marketing.

ExxonMobil:

Ranking among the largest oil and gas company, ExxonMobil is the leading international company and inventory of global oil and gas resources. It also is among the world’s largest refiner and marketer of petroleum and chemical products.

Though ExxonMobil has to deal with various controversial issues on grounds of environmental safety and human rights, it continues to expand and grow its business around the world. It invests heavily in oil markets globally expanding its reach. Currently ExxonMobil operates in most part of the world and are known by their familiar brands like, Exxon, Mobil and Esso.
